Chilling -video shows a sick FireBug who quietly set a homeless woman on fire – burned her so seriously and she was intubated and unable to identify her attacker for a few weeks, according to the police.

The disturbing images of the security camera that were released on Wednesday shows a car that makes a U-turn and then crossed where a 49-year-old woman slept in a Sacramento Street on 26 April.

The driver then gets out quietly, holds a bus and walks to the sleeping woman – suppresses her with an unknown liquid, shows the clip.

Suddenly the woman burst into an eruption of flames, according to the video. The driver then seems to argue with someone before he goes behind the wheel again and peeling off.

The victim suffered serious burns to about a third of her body-including her face, trunk, arms and backs and was intubated in a local hospital for more than two weeks.

She recovered enough to speak with researchers on Tuesday and is said to have identified her attacker as Jacqueline Popaibarra, 34, according to the Sacramento County Sheriff’s Office.

The identification of the victim has not been released.

Jacqueline Popaibarra, 34, is held on a $ 400,000 bail. Sacramento County Sheriff’s Office

Both women knew each other, said the Sheriff office, without working in what the horrible attack could have motivated.

It was also not immediately clear how Popaibarra set fire to the sleeping woman.

Popaibarra, who is not homeless, even kicked the burning victim before she fled, said the Sheriff office.

Popaibarra was already in custody of the Sacramento police on a non -related robbery when she was identified as the suspected Firebug.
